About Osaka (OSA)

Located on the main island of Honshu, Osaka, literally means “large slope” or “large hill”, is the second most populous city in the entire nation. The city acts as a centre of commerce and is a hub for the world's most famous corporations and one of the internationalized and globally competitive companies of Japan. The Osaka City Council is the city's local government and is formed under the Local Autonomy Law. The city is served by two airports: Kansal International Airport handles all international flights and Osaka International Airport which handles all the domestic flights and other local transport services such as ferry services, rail services and bus services. The city is also a home for various museums and art galleries such as National Museum of Art which has a collections from the post war era, Osaka Science Museum with a planetarium, Museum of Oriental Ceramics which holds around 2000 pieces of ceramics from various countries, One hand, Osaka Municipal Museum of Art holds pieces of Japanese and Chinese paintings and sculptures, whereas on the other hand, Osaka Museum of Natural History holds a collection related to natural history and life and Osaka Maritime Museum which is accessible only through an underwater tunnel into its dome. Osaka Aquarium Kaiyukan is one of the world's largest aquariums and has a lot of sea creatures. Universal Studios Japan is one of the largest theme parks showcasing some of the favourite characters of the movies. The city also has some religious places such as Osaka Castle, Sanko Shrine and Shitenno ji which is one of the oldest Buddhist temple in Japan. Dotonbari is an iconic tourist nightlife area. Namba and Shinsaibashi districts offer countless options for shopping, restaurants, bars and nightclubs. About Munich (MUC)

Famous for its architecture, fine culture and Oktoberfest Beer celebration, Munich is the capital city of Bavaria. Located at the river Isar in the south of Bavaria, it is the third most populous city in Germany. It is the financial and publishing hub and has the strongest economy of any German city. Termed as the Global City, it has the headquarters of many big manufacturing companies of the world. Munich has one of the most extensive and punctual transport systems in the world with the facilities of buses, trams, cycling and many others. Franz Joseph Strauss International Airport is one of the second largest airports in Germany. There are other airports present in the city. The quality of architecture has always amazed the tourists in the city and some of the museums also outrank Berlin in terms of quality. It is always considered as a major international centre of business, engineering and research followed by two research universities, multinational companies, world class technology and science museums. It is worldwide known for its cluster of ancient, classic and modern art which can be found in museums throughout the city. The city is also a host to many famous composers and musicians. The Deutsches Museum is one of the largest and oldest science museums in the world and has always attracted people from all over the world. There are several famous and important art galleries present in the city. Four grand royal avenues, Briennerstrasse, Ludwigstrasse, Maxmillanstrasse, Prinzregentenstrasse of 19th century with magnificent architectures run throughout the inner city of Munich. Frauenkirche is a major landmark and an important attraction to all tourists. Munich is a green city with numerous parks present all over the city. One of the most famous park is Engllscher Garden which is a wonderful place to relax. It is a place full of restaurants, clubs, offering amazing nightlife with worldwide cuisines. Munich is famous for its breweries. The Viktualienmrkt is the most popular market for fresh food and delicacies. About Tiger Airways

Tiger Airways, operating as Tigerair is a low cost airline, with its headquarters in Singapore. Though the airline may not have too many international destinations on its schedule, it does cover a few important destinations in most parts of Asia, including India and China. It has also won several awards that include Top Airline by Growth in Cargo Carriage and in Passenger Carriage at the Changi Airline Awards and the Best in-flight meals in low cost airline category at the Asia Pacific Airline Food Awards. Tigerair offers facilities such as online booking and web check-in, which has made air travel easy for passengers. The airline has tie-ups with Tiger Australia, Mandala and Seair Pacific, which allows it to have a greater worldwide reach.
